Question

Which equilibrium constant expression(s) are for the following reaction. (X stands for the mole fraction of the indicated substance in its phase, which we have so far assumed equal to unity (one) for essentially pure phases.)

NH3(g) + H3O+(aq) NH4+(aq) + H2O(l)
Choose from the list below and enter the letters alphabetical order. (e.g. AH)

A) (pNH3)eq              I) (pNH3)eq3
B) [H3O+]eq            J) [H3O+]eq3
C) [NH4+]eq            K) [NH4+]eq4
D) (XH2O)eq           L) (XH2O)eq2
E) (pNH3)eq-1        M) (pNH3)eq-3
F) [H3O+]eq-1         N) [H3O+]eq-3
G) [NH4+]eq-1       O) [NH4+]eq-4
H) (XH2O)eq-1        P) (XH2O)eq-2

Explanation / Answer

NH3(g) + H3O+(aq) NH4+(aq) + H2O(l)

For this equation, equilibrium constant is give by the following expression=[NH4+]/pNH3[H3O+]

So the possible expression is CDEF

that is [NH4+]eq(XH2O)eq(pNH3)eq-1[H3O+]eq-1
